The trailer for A24’s Onslaught boasts a chilling warning: “To stop a killing machine, you must become one.”

This sets the haunting tone for Adam Wingard's upcoming action thriller film, starring Adria Arjona as a former soldier forced to go against a rogue squad of genetically modified super-soldiers. The official synopsis for the movie reads as follows:

''A mother living in a trailer park struggles to protect her family from a threat that has escaped from a secret military facility.''

Adam Wingard is best known for his works in the horror and action genres, especially films like Godzilla vs. Kong and its sequel Godzilla x Kong: The New Empire. The acclaimed filmmaker’s upcoming feature blends action and horror, delivering a dark and unsettling story packed with thrills and terror.

A24 recently unveiled the official Onslaught trailer, starring Adria Arjona as Celeste, a single mother forced to fight a squad of super soldiers who escaped from a secret military facility. Celeste has combat experience but her new enemies are literal killing machines with glowing eyes, masks and a determination to destroy the entire population.

Adam Wingard's Onslaught 2026 trailer kicks off with Adria Arjona's Celeste, a former soldier and a single mother living off the grid in a trailer park with her young daughter. As a fellow soldier advises Celeste to ''get her sh*t together'' and go back into her world, she maintains that she wants to raise her daughter in peace and safety. Moments later, the trailer becomes tense as Celeste notices a familiar Blackhawk helicopter hovering back and forth in her area.

The Onslaught trailer takes a haunting turn as it reveals the helicopter's cargo: experimental super-soldiers from a top-secret facility. These genetically engineered super-soldiers are designed as human equivalents of a missile and pose an immense threat to Adria Arjona's character and her daughter. In one scene from the trailer, Celeste describes these genetic monsters as:

''These men are conditioned to kill until they are stopped.''

The movie positions the genetic soldiers as monsters, ready to take down the populace. The trailer concludes with a fast-moving montage of action-packed sequences as Celeste gears up to take out her powerful foes (using a chainsaw) and protect her daughter. On the other hand, tensions escalate as the government launches its own mission to recapture the super soldiers and to cover their destructive tracks.


Onslaught 2026: Meet the movie's cast

Adam Wingard's upcoming action-thriller movie stars American actress Adria Arjona as Celeste, a single mother who races against time to protect her daughter from dangerous foes. Arjona, best known for her breakout role as Bix Caleen in Tony Gilroy's Star Wars prequel series Andor, has had a big impact on the big and small screens in recent years.

Recently, the actress led Netflix's rom-com crime movie Hit Man, opposite Glen Powell, Michael Angelo Covino's comedy film Splitsville, alongside Dakota Johnson and Zoë Kravitz's psychological thriller film Blink Twice, alongside Channing Tatum and Christian Slater. In addition to Adam Wingard's Onslaught 2026, Adria Arjona has an exciting lineup of upcoming projects, including James Gunn's Man of Tomorrow and Ed Brubaker and Jordan Harper's crime drama series Criminal on Prime Video.

Rounding out the Onslaught cast are actors Dan Stevens, Alex Pereira, Eric Wareheim, Reginald VelJohnson, Michael Biehn, Drew Starkey, Rebecca Hall and Maurice Greene.

Onslaught is scheduled to be released in the United States on September 4.
